Funny Garter Toss Songs

  1. “Mission Impossible Theme” by Lalo Schifrin: Perfect for creating a humorous, movie-like atmosphere for the garter toss, making the groom feel like a secret agent on a mission.
  2. “Another One Bites the Dust” by Queen: Catchy beat and humorous overtones, perfect for a garter toss.
  3. “Hot in Herre” by Nelly: “It’s getting hot in here, so take off all your clothes,” adds a cheeky and humorous element to the garter removal, perfectly capturing the playful side of the tradition.
  4. “SexyBack” by Justin Timberlake: With its catchy beat and cheeky lyrics, this song is sure to bring some laughs and energy to the occasion.
  5. “I’m Too Sexy” by Right Said Fred: This song’s humorous take on being “too sexy” is perfect for a lighthearted garter toss.
  6. “Can’t Touch This” by MC Hammer: The iconic beat and catchy chorus of this track add a lively and humorous energy to the event.
  7. The Stripper” by David Rose: Known for its use in comedic scenes, this instrumental track adds a classic humorous touch.
  8. “You Sexy Thing” by Hot Chocolate: This song’s confident and playful lyrics can add a fun and flirty vibe to the garter toss.
  9. “Macho Man” by The Village People: Its upbeat tempo and humorous lyrics make it a great fit for a playful garter toss moment.
  10. “Legs” by ZZ Top: “She’s got legs, she knows how to use them,” this song brings a fun and slightly naughty twist.

Spanish Garter Toss Songs

  1. “Despacito” by Luis Fonsi: Global hit, flirty, sexy, an excellent choice 🙂
  2. “Gasolina” by Daddy Yankee: This energetic reggaeton track is sure to get everyone moving, making the garter toss a high-energy and fun part of your reception.
  3. Bailando” by Enrique Iglesias: Its lively rhythm and infectious chorus make it a popular choice for a fun wedding moment.
  4. “Livin’ la Vida Loca” by Ricky Martin: This classic hit with its energetic beat and catchy lyrics is sure to get everyone in a party mood.
  5. “La Bicicleta” by Carlos Vives and Shakira: “Que te sueño y que te quiero tanto.” – “That I dream of you and love you so much.” This line adds a romantic and playful vibe to the garter toss.
  6. “Danza Kuduro” by Don Omar: This fast-paced, reggaeton track is perfect for adding a high-energy, danceable vibe to the garter toss.
  7. “Hips Don’t Lie” by Shakira (Spanish version): Known for its infectious beat and Shakira’s signature vocals, this song brings a fun and flirty element to the garter toss.
  8. “El Perdón” by Nicky Jam and Enrique Iglesias: Dime si es verdad… Me dijeron que te estás casando.” – “Tell me if it’s true… They told me you are getting married.” This lyric about marriage is fitting for the wedding context, adding a touch of romantic twist to the garter toss.
  9. “Baila Baila Baila” by Ozuna: The song’s upbeat tempo and catchy chorus make it a great choice for an exciting moment.
  10. “Mi Gente” by J Balvin and Willy William: Vibrant beat and catchy melody, great to start a party!

Country Garter Toss Songs

  1. “Honey Bee” by Blake Shelton: This sweet and upbeat track is perfect for a romantic yet fun moment in a country setting.
  2. “Country Girl (Shake It for Me)” by Luke Bryan: This upbeat song is perfect for a country-themed wedding, with its catchy chorus and playful lyrics.
  3. “Boot Scootin’ Boogie” by Brooks & Dunn: A classic country line-dancing song that’s sure to get guests moving and add a fun, honky-tonk vibe to your garter toss.
  4. “Wagon Wheel” by Darius Rucker: This feel-good song combines a catchy chorus with a laid-back, country vibe, ideal for a fun and relaxed toss.
  5. “Save a Horse (Ride a Cowboy)” by Big & Rich: Known for its cheeky lyrics, this song adds a humorous and lively twist.
  6. “Chicken Fried” by Zac Brown Band: With its feel-good lyrics and melody, this song brings a warm country charm.
  7. “Copperhead Road” by Steve Earle: This song, with its distinctive intro and catchy beat, adds a bit of country-rock edge.
  8. “House Party” by Sam Hunt: This modern country hit, with its upbeat tempo and party vibe, is perfect for a fun and energetic garter toss.
